Wind, solar, and hydroelectric power are all forms of renewable energy that are increasingly being utilized to power our world. Steel lubricating plain bearings play a crucial role in the efficient operation of these new energy systems. These bearings are specifically designed to withstand the unique challenges presented by renewable energy applications, such as variable loads, high speeds, and harsh environments.
The lubrication properties of , combined with the strength and durability of steel, create bearings that are ideal for use in wind turbines, solar trackers, and hydroelectric turbines. These bearings provide smooth and reliable operation, ensuring that energy is efficiently converted from natural sources into usable electricity.
As the demand for renewable energy continues to grow, so does the need for high-performance bearings that can keep these systems running smoothly. Steel lubricating plain bearings are a vital component of this effort, helping to power our future with clean and sustainable energy.

Strusture
1. /Fibre mixture thickness 0.01~0.03mm. It is the contact surface for the rotating shaft. Minute partides of the layer and the sintered bronze material combine to create a solid lubricant film, which coats the shaft.
2. Sintered bronze powder thickness 0.20*0.35mm,A special composition of powdered copper is thermally fused to the steel backing. This contact layer acts as an anchor for the layer and conducts the thermal build up away from the bearing surfaces.
3. Low-carbon steel backing. Setting the foundation of the bushings, the steel back provides exceptional stability, load carrying and heat dissipation characteristics.

Technical data
|
Max. load |
Static |
250N/mm2 |
|
Dynamic |
140N/mm2 |
|
|
Max. speed |
Dry |
2m/s |
|
Lubrication |
>2m/s |
|
|
Max. PV (Dry) |
Short-time |
3.6N/mm2*·m/s |
|
Continuous |
1.8N/mm2*·m/s |
|
|
Temp. |
-195℃~+280℃ |
|
|
Friction coefficient |
0.03~0.20 |
|
|
Thermal conductivity |
42W (m·k)-1 |
|
|
Coefficient of thermal expansion |
11*10-6k-1 |
